Service Description

This course is designed to give Law Enforcement and Public Safety Firearms Instructors a firm understanding of the principles, and effective use of the pistol red dot system (RDS) and its overall benefits. Our blocks of instruction build on each other, taking the “baby steps” needed for everyone to get a good grasp of the plan. The skillsets delivered will be demonstrated and explained allowing for questions taking care of the “Why?”. The instructions set forth are not meant to discredit or replace any of your department’s policies or procedures, merely to be used as advice and guidance on the delivered topic. It is recommended that Instructors take a recertification course every 3 years to stay up to date with advancements and upgrades to equipment and instructional views. Upon Successful Completion of this course attendees will be provided an instructor level certificate. Prerequisites: ***Must be Active-Duty Law Enforcement Firearms Instructor. We will cover: • Some History • Types of Red Dots • Selecting your RDS • Mounting and Maintenance • Zeroing your dot • Offset (Holdover) Why the dot! • Target Focus & Use of Force Decision making • All the benefits • Pros and Cons Fundamentals: • Transitioning to Target Focus • Proper Presentation and Sight Alignment Live-Fire Training: • Confirming Zero • Trigger Control • The Glass • Corrective Actions • Multiple Shots/Targets • Shooting on the Move • Task Standards Instructor Principles: • The Delivery • The Demonstration • Building Confidence • Answering the Questions • Teach back …and more!
